Choosing the right broker is a crucial step in trading binary options. A good broker will provide you with the necessary tools and support to make informed trading decisions and help you achieve your financial goals. Here are some tips on how to choose the right broker for binary options trading:

Reputation and Regulation: The first thing you should check when choosing a broker is their reputation and regulatory status. Look for brokers who are regulated by reputable financial authorities like the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A), the Cyprus Securities and Exchange Commission (CySEC), or the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C). A regulated broker is more likely to be trustworthy and reliable.

Asset Coverage: A good broker should offer a wide range of assets for trading, including currency pairs, stocks, commodities, and indices. Make sure the broker offers the assets you are interested in trading.

Trading Platform: The broker's trading platform is the software you use to execute your trades. It should be easy to use, intuitive, and provide you with the necessary tools and resources to make informed trading decisions.

Payouts and Fees: Look for a broker that offers competitive payouts and low fees. The payouts should be high enough to make your trades profitable, and the fees should be low enough to avoid eating into your profits.

Customer Support: A good broker should provide excellent customer support, including live chat, phone support, and email support. The customer support team should be knowledgeable and responsive to your needs.

Demo Account: Look for brokers that offer a demo account. A demo account allows you to practice trading with virtual money before risking your own funds. It is a great way to test the broker's trading platform and your trading strategies.

Bonuses and Promotions: While bonuses and promotions can be tempting, make sure you read the terms and conditions carefully before accepting them. Some brokers offer bonuses that come with strict trading requirements, making it difficult to withdraw your profits.

In summary, choosing the right broker is essential for successful binary options trading. Do your research and choose a broker that is regulated, offers a wide range of assets, has a user-friendly trading platform, provides competitive payouts and low fees, offers excellent customer support, and provides a demo account for practice trading.
